We’ve all seen top ten lists of things you can do to save the environment. You can usually find them at the end of books about the end of the world or on activist websites.
More often than not, they are somebody’s list of favourite actions, not anything that is designed to really make a difference
Ours is different. Very different. Our top ten list is at the heart of our activities, from our campaigns and information services to the way we are organizing a united movement.
- Our list reflects the ecological cycle. It starts with nature, flows through key resource and consumption choices, and ends up with the waste we return to nature.
- Our list also closely matches the key categories under the ecological footprint model: home, transportation, energy, and food.
- Our list recognizes that we are all different and live in different circumstances. We give you the high level action, and it’s up to you to decide how you can best take action.
- Each of the ten actions also represents an area of focus for the environmental movement as a whole. This means that for each action, we can point you to groups that help you. In fact, we’ve designed our whole provincial voluntary transition strategy around these ten actions.
In other words, our top ten list of actions will help connect your personal commitment into a growing and united movement. Together, we can transform Ontario into a conserver society. Neat, huh.
